Inside the $22 trillion world of private capital, an asset class so big it would be the world’s second-largest economy
PositiveFinancial Markets
The private capital market, valued at an astonishing $22 trillion, is becoming a significant player in the global economy, potentially ranking as the second-largest economy worldwide. Within this vast landscape, the emerging private credit sector, estimated to be worth between $1.5 trillion and $3 trillion, is set to play a crucial role in supporting the anticipated data-center expansion in 2025. This growth not only highlights the increasing importance of private investments but also signals a shift in how infrastructure projects are financed, making it a pivotal moment for investors and the economy alike.

Country superstar taking over historic Las Vegas Strip venue
PositiveFinancial Markets
The Flamingo Las Vegas, a historic venue on the Las Vegas Strip, is set to welcome a country superstar, marking a new chapter in its nearly 80-year legacy. Opened by mobster Bugsy Siegel in 1946, the Flamingo has been a symbol of glitz and reinvention in the entertainment capital. This new performance not only highlights the venue's enduring appeal but also signifies the ongoing evolution of Las Vegas as a premier destination for diverse entertainment.
OpenAI shunned advisers on $1.5tn of deals
NeutralFinancial Markets
OpenAI's CEO Sam Altman has chosen to rely on a select group of in-house dealmakers instead of traditional bankers and lawyers for structuring significant infrastructure agreements worth $1.5 trillion. This approach highlights a shift in how major deals are negotiated in the tech industry, emphasizing internal expertise over external advisors. It matters because it could set a precedent for other companies to follow suit, potentially reshaping the landscape of corporate deal-making.
Bessent says China to delay rare earths rules by a year, buy U.S. soybeans
PositiveFinancial Markets
In a significant development for international trade, Bessent announced that China will delay its new rare earths regulations by a year, which is a relief for many industries reliant on these materials. Additionally, China plans to increase its purchases of U.S. soybeans, signaling a potential thaw in trade tensions. This news is important as it could stabilize markets and foster better relations between the two countries, benefiting both economies.
